Step 6

Parts Needed For

Corners

6515 Wall Panel (2)

9373 Front Wall Panel (2)
6514 Corner Panel (4)

NOTE

The remainder of the building assembly

requires many hours and more than one

person. Do not continue beyond this point

if you do not have enough time to com­

plete the assembly today. A partially

assembled building can be severely

damaged by light winds.

Each screw and bolt in the wall re­

quires a washer.

1

Position a

corner panel at the

corner of the floor frame as shown.
The widest part of each corner panel

must be placed along the side of the
building for all four corners. Fasten

the corner panel to the floor frame
with four screw.

STEP

6514

SIDE

6514

Support the corner panel with a step
ladder until a wall panel is attached.

2

Attach the

front wall panels

to the

frontcornerpanels, as shown. Asmall
gap will exist between front wall panel
and ramp.

3

Attach the

wall panels

to the rear

corner panels, as shown.

NOTE

Be careful to install the correct

panel in each position as shown

6515

6515

4

Double-check the part numbers of

the wall panels, before proceeding.

The floor frame must be square

and level or holes will not align.
